| Sumario: | The paper presented here analyzes the strengthening and consolidation of the technical skills of the work done by the Ecuadorian Network of Human breastmilk Banks during the period of time between the years 2015 to 2017 in the South-South Brazil-Ecuador Cooperation context. Employing as theoretical framework the South-South Cooperation and constructivists theory. The methodology has being made through qualitative research, supported with data recollection such as: first and second hand documentary sources, and semi-structured interviews, mainly to the officials of the human breastmilk banks in cities of Quito and Ambato. The first chapter showcases conceptual approaches towards the concepts of International Health, Global Health and Diplomacy Health references, followed up by the growth and evolution of the South-South Cooperation. The second chapter showcases the most known public institutions from Ecuador and Brazil linked in matters of breast milk cooperation. The third chapter speaks about the improvements that can be done and are necessary to programs like the ones mentioned above |
